THE IMPORTANCE OF BIBLE TRUTH
Is Bible Truth important to your Faith and Salvation ie. will you be saved despite what you believe the bible teaches or does it matter what you believe?
Well the word “truth” appears 237 times in the bible, that alone says it must be important!
Therefore it must be important to understand what “truth” is.
A quick scan of the passages using this word “truth” leave us in no doubt that it is not only important, but vital to our salvation.
John 17:3
3 And this is life eternal, that they might know thee the only true God, and Jesus Christ, whom thou hast sent.
1 John 5:20
20And we know that the Son of God is come, and hath given us an understanding, that we may know him that is true, and we are in him that is true,even in his Son Jesus Christ. This is the true God, and eternal life.
1 Timothy 2:3-4
3For thisis good and acceptable in the sight of God our Saviour; 4 Who will have all men to be saved, and to come unto the knowledge of the truth.
Clearly then knowing what is Bible Truth is important and vital, in addition to this we are also warned that some would depart from the “truth”…
1 Timothy 4:1
1Now the Spirit speaketh expressly, that in the latter times some shall depart from the faith giving heed to seducing spirits, and doctrines of devils; 2 Speaking lies in hypocrisy; having their conscience seared with a hot iron; 3 Forbidding to marry,and commanding to abstain from meats, which God hath created to be received with thanksgiving of them which believe and know the truth.
1 John 4:6
6We are of God: he that knoweth God heareth us; he that is not of God heareth not us. Hereby know we the spirit of truth, and the spirit of error.
From these passages it is very clear that we need to know the “truth” about God and His Son as it is taught to us in the Bible. This means we must learn what this is from the Bible itself.
We have all been warned by God that there would be many false teachers and Jesus himself has told us that "Because strait is the gate, and narrow is the way, which leadeth unto life, and few there be that find it." See Matthew 7:14
Sadly when Christ returns to this earth, many will only then realise that they have believed in lies Jeremiah 16:19
"19 O LORD, my strength, and my fortress, and my refuge in the day of affliction, the Gentiles shall come unto thee from the ends of the earth, and shall say, Surely our fathers have inherited lies, vanity, and things wherein there is no profit."

The Bible is our only true source for the Truth!
If we claim to follow Christ we should trust in the Scriptures as confidently as Jesus and his Apostles did:
Jesus said that: The Scripture cannot be broken. (John 10:35)
Paul said that: All scripture is given by inspiration of God, and is profitable for doctrine, for reproof, for correction, for instruction in righteousness. (2 Timothy 3:16)
Peter said that: For prophecy never came by the will of man, but holy men of God spoke as they were moved by the Holy Spirit (2 Peter 1:21)
The things which now have been reported to you through those who have preached the gospel to you by the Holy Spirit sent from heaven (1 Peter 1:12)
True faith must be founded on a fully inspired Bible.
